What implant brands do you use?
Straumann · Neodent · Nobel Biocare only. Lot numbers of the specific fixtures placed in your mouth are documented in your surgical file and printed on your warranty certificate.
Is the Straumann I would get in the UK the same as the one here?
Yes — identical. Straumann manufactures in Switzerland for both markets. You can cross-reference the lot number on your warranty with the manufacturer if you choose.
What does the written warranty actually cover?
10 years on implant fixtures (manufacturer-pass-through). 5 years on crowns and veneers. 2 years on endodontic treatment. 2 years on soft-tissue grafting. Full terms set out on our

What happens if a crown or veneer cracks in year four?
Replaced at our cost under the written warranty, provided the three warranty conditions (annual review, routine hygiene, no trauma) are met. Typically 2–3 day return trip for single-unit work.
Why is GC Clinic priced so differently from UK private?
UK clinic overheads, regulatory costs, and professional fees in London are several times higher than in Istanbul. The implant, porcelain and consumables themselves cost the same. You are not paying for cheaper components — you are paying for a different cost base.
Will I end up paying more than the headline quote?
The quote you receive is priced line by line. Complications — if they arise — are covered by the written warranty. If additional clinical work emerges during treatment (which is rare after CBCT-led planning), you would be informed and consent would be taken before anything was done.
How long will I be in Istanbul?
Single implant: 3–4 working days for placement, then 3–6 months healing at home, then 2–3 days for the final crown. Veneers: 5–7 days in one visit. All-on-4: 7 days visit 1, 4 days visit 2. Exact timeline is in your plan.
Do I need to travel with someone?
For most single-visit procedures, no. For full-arch surgery, we recommend a companion for the first trip; most subsequent visits are done alone.
Can I fly straight after surgery?
Usually yes — for single implant or veneer work, you can fly the day after surgery. For more complex cases we suggest 48–72 hours before departure. Specific guidance is in your plan.
